Quick answer: Casper Spins withdrawal times
PayPal clears same day to 24 hours. Open Banking transfers take 1-3 business days. Visa and Mastercard debit withdrawals take 3-5 business days. Every method runs through an internal review first, so add a few hours before the clock even starts on the payment provider's side.

How Casper Spins Withdrawals Work

Casper Spins doesn't release funds the second you click confirm. The casino runs every withdrawal through an internal review first, then sends it to whichever payment provider you picked. That two-stage system runs across most UK-facing casinos, but it means the status on your screen reading "processing" doesn't equal money sitting in your bank account yet.

Sort your account details before you submit anything. Casper Spins asks for a name that matches across your casino account and your payment method, letter for letter, and a mismatch here is the fastest way to stall a Casper Spins withdrawal for days instead of hours.

  • Account Verification: upload ID and proof of address on your first deposit, not your first withdrawal.
  • Choose a Method: PayPal, debit card, or an Open Banking transfer, each with a different clearing time.
  • Confirm the Amount: stay above the minimum withdrawal threshold Casper Spins sets for that method.
  • Submit and Wait: Casper Spins holds your money in a pending status during its internal review window before sending it to the provider.

Check your email and your account inbox once you submit the request. Casper Spins sometimes flags a request for extra ID, and answering that message the same day keeps your Casper Spins withdrawal processed within the normal window instead of pushed to the back of a queue.

Requesting a Withdrawal at Casper Spins

The request takes under two minutes once your account is verified, though getting there is where most delays start.

Even so, Casper Spins won't release a withdrawal until you've cleared any wagering tied to a bonus and your ID documents sit approved in the system. Skip either step and Casper Spins bounces the request back, asking for more information and adding a day or two before processing starts.

  1. Log into your Casper Spins account with your username and password.
  2. Head to the cashier and select Withdraw.
  3. Pick your payment method: PayPal, Visa or Mastercard debit, or an Open Banking transfer.
  4. Enter the amount, staying inside the daily withdrawal limit for that method.
  5. Confirm the request and wait for the status to change from pending to approved.

You can submit a Casper Spins withdrawal request through the cashier at any hour, but the review team works standard business hours. Submit at 11pm on a Friday and your request sits until Monday morning before anyone looks at it.

What Affects Casper Spins Withdrawal Times

Method matters most. PayPal and other e-wallets clear faster because the money never touches a card network. Debit cards and bank transfers route through Faster Payments or the card scheme's own settlement window, adding a day or two on top of whatever Casper Spins takes to review the request internally.

Withdrawal MethodEstimated Time
PayPalSame day to 24 hours
Visa/Mastercard Debit3-5 business days
Open Banking / Faster Payments1-3 business days
Pay by Phone (Boku)Deposit only, not available for withdrawals

Casper Spins Withdrawal Time by Payment Method

Casper Spins withdrawal times split into two camps: e-wallets and everything else. My PayPal withdrawals landed inside 24 hours on two out of three attempts, with the third taking closer to 36 hours after landing on a bank holiday weekend. Both debit card withdrawals I ran took four business days, matching what the terms page promises.

Anyone comparing Casper Spins withdrawal times against other UK-facing casinos will find e-wallets sit at the fast end almost everywhere, while bank-linked methods depend more on your own bank's clearing schedule than on the casino itself.

For a Casper Spins withdrawal from a UK bank account, Faster Payments handles most of the settlement once Casper Spins releases the funds, which happens within one business day of approval in most cases. Weekends and bank holidays don't count toward that internal window, so a Friday afternoon request often doesn't move until Tuesday.

From testing: what actually shows up in your account
Three PayPal withdrawals, two debit card withdrawals, one Open Banking transfer. The PayPal requests posted in under a day twice and just under two days once. The debit card money landed on day four both times. Nothing arrived faster than the terms page suggested, but nothing arrived slower either.

Casper Spins Withdrawal Limits

Casper Spins sets a minimum withdrawal of £10 across most methods, with a daily cap that sits higher for card and bank withdrawals than for e-wallets. Check the cashier page for your specific method before you submit a request, since limits shift now and then without much notice.
